How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hansen Area?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Hansen Area Studio Apartments | $850 | $850 | $850 |
| Hansen Area 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,236 | $950 | $1,595 |
| Hansen Area 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,236 | $950 | $1,650 |
| Hansen Area 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,574 | $1,395 | $1,650 |
| Hansen Area 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,500 | $2,500 | $2,500 |
